October 12th, 1979

NHTSA Campaign Number: 73V026000
Manufacturer: STREAMLINE MFG., INC.
Manufactured Begin Date: August 1st, 1971
Manufactured End Date: November 1st, 1972
Date of Owner Notification: February 15th, 1973

Recall Notes:
STREAMLINE CAMPAIGN NO N/A.ALL 29', 31', & 33' TRAVEL TRAILERS BUILT BETWEENAUG 1 1971 & NOV 30 1972.POSSIBILITY THAT THE WHEELS FURNISHED BYKELSEY-HAYES CO.WERE MANUFACTURED FROM STEEL STOCK THICKNESS WITH LOADCARRYING CAPACITY OF 1,550 LBS PER WHEEL INSTEAD OF REQUIRED 2,000 POUNDS.(CORRECT BY INSPECTING AND REPLACING WHEELS WITH WHEEL LOAD CARRYING CAPACITYOF 2000 POUNDS.)
